Freddy Pascal, a tech store owner, said a trio of burglars broke into his store on Tremont Avenue at 5:30 a.m. Monday during the blizzard.
Exclusive surveillance video shows the trio approach "Pascal Tech" in the thick of the snowstorm.
One suspect is seen holding a large bag while the other two use power tools to cut through the metal gate.
"They are experts. They got the masks and gloves and the tools... everything," said Pascal.
The three thieves then use one of the tools to smash the glass door.
Video shows the three suspects entering the store and splitting up. One person walked behind the counter while the other two entered the back room.
One of the suspects grabbed items from the shelves and threw them into a bag.
Pascal said the trio stole cash from the register, customer cellphones that were being repaired and other merchandise.
He said the total value lost is more than $50,000.
"It's breaking my heart..." said Pascal. "Now we struggle... and now we have to see what we're going to do."
No arrests have been made, according to police.
"Anybody that recognizes those suspects, please help us to get those phones back so we can return it to the customers," said Pascal.
